...WIND ADVISORY REMAINS IN EFFECT UNTIL MIDNIGHT MDT TONIGHT...

* WHAT...Southwest winds 30 to 40 mph with gusts up to 60 mph
  occuring.

* WHERE...Beartooth Foothills and Livingston Area.

* WHEN...Until midnight MDT tonight.

* IMPACTS...Gusty winds will blow around unsecured objects. Strong
  crosswinds will make travel difficult along Interstate 90 from
  Livingston to Big Timber and roads along the Beartooth Foothills.
  Warm and dry conditions could cause rapid fire spread. Use caution
  not to create a spark.

* ADDITIONAL DETAILS...Strongest winds are expect during the
  advisory, but winds will remain elevated through Saturday
  afternoon.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

Winds this strong can make driving difficult, especially for high
profile vehicles. Use extra caution and consider postponing travel
until winds subside, or take an alternate route.

Secure outdoor objects.

...WIND ADVISORY IN EFFECT FROM 3 AM TO 6 PM MDT SATURDAY...

* WHAT...Northwest winds 25 to 35 mph with gusts up to 55 mph
  expected.

* WHERE...Portions of northwestern and western South Dakota.

* WHEN...From 3 AM to 6 PM MDT Saturday.

* IMPACTS...Sudden wind gusts can cause drivers to lose control,
  especially in lightweight or high profile vehicles. Strong winds
  can cause blowing dust, reduced visibility, and flying debris.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

Winds this strong can make driving difficult, especially for high
profile vehicles. Use extra caution.
